Transaction 31da86f74734426eefdfad26142f0c8704e1c38f8bde65b96948e0849b262d36
1 Input
1 Output
-
31da86f74734426eefdfad26142f0c8704e1c38f8bde65b96948e0849b262d36:0
- value
- 2035263
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f0e0cb8970963fdb16ee7eab0719f0b936a4db3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13qCn8uxEC6ThpFGVrCE3LVzV2yxAy6mWM